What people with Diabetes in Ripley usually need help with

Diabetes is highly prevalent among older Australians and requires careful daily management to prevent complications such as foot ulcers, kidney disease, and vision loss. Home care services through a Home Care Package or the Support at Home program can fund nursing for wound care and medication management, as well as personal care and allied health supports. Regular nursing visits at home can help older people with diabetes maintain stable blood sugar levels and reduce the risk of serious complications.

How does exercise help with diabetes management and can I access this at home in Ripley?
Regular exercise is one of the most effective tools for managing type 2 diabetes, improving insulin sensitivity and blood glucose control. Exercise physiologists in Ripley can provide home-based programs tailored to your fitness level and any other health conditions. Understanding Diabetes Mellitus (Type 1 and Type 2)

Diabetes is a chronic condition affecting how the body processes blood glucose. Type 2 diabetes is the most common form in older Australians, affecting approximately 1.3 million people, with many more undiagnosed. Diabetes causes complications affecting the eyes (retinopathy), kidneys (nephropathy), nerves (neuropathy), and cardiovascular system. For older Australians, managing diabetes involves blood glucose monitoring, medication adherence, dietary management, foot care, and regular screening for complications. Unmanaged diabetes accelerates other age-related conditions and significantly increases the risk of heart disease, stroke, amputation, and kidney failure. Home-based support for older Australians with diabetes focuses on maintaining health routines that prevent complications and supporting daily living when complications have already occurred.

How diabetes affects daily life

Diabetes affects daily life through the constant need for blood glucose management, medication timing, dietary planning, and complication monitoring. Meals must be planned with carbohydrate content in mind. Blood glucose testing may be needed multiple times daily. Insulin injections (for those who require them) must be timed correctly. Peripheral neuropathy causes numbness, tingling, and pain in the feet, increasing falls risk and the chance of unnoticed injuries. Foot ulcers can develop from minor injuries and may lead to amputation if not treated promptly. Diabetic retinopathy affects vision. Fatigue and cognitive changes can accompany poorly controlled blood sugar. Many older Australians with diabetes also manage multiple other conditions, making the medication and monitoring regime complex.

What to look for in a provider

Good diabetes providers ensure that all workers understand the basics of blood glucose management, including recognising hypoglycaemia (low blood sugar) and hyperglycaemia (high blood sugar). Ask whether their nurses can manage insulin administration, whether they provide foot care and inspection, and whether they coordinate with the person's GP, endocrinologist, and podiatrist. Red flags include providers whose workers cannot recognise the signs of hypo or hyperglycaemia, who do not check feet regularly, or who prepare meals without considering the person's dietary requirements.

How to access funding

For older Australians, diabetes support is accessed through My Aged Care (1800 200 422). An ACAT/ACAS assessment determines eligibility for a Home Care Package. The Commonwealth Home Support Programme provides lower-level support. The National Diabetes Services Scheme (NDSS) provides subsidised blood glucose monitoring supplies, insulin pump consumables, and continuous glucose monitors. Diabetes Australia provides education and support resources.

Home Care Package budgets range from ~$9,500/yr (Level 1) to ~$37,500/yr (Level 3). Most older people with diabetes need Level 1-2 for daily monitoring support, progressing to Level 3-4 if complications develop.

Nursing visits for insulin management and health monitoring cost $75-$120/hr. Podiatry visits cost $80-$150/session. Blood glucose supplies are subsidised through the NDSS.

Figures are indicative and based on the current NDIS Price Guide and published Home Care Package rates. Actual costs depend on your plan, provider, and location.
